When you click on links to various merchants on this site and make a purchase, this can result in this site earning a commission. Affiliate programs and affiliations include, but are not limited to, the eBay Partner Network.
What tables would SUBTRACK timing? In my main SA table, I have specified 36 degrees of SA at WOT, however according to my data logs, I am only getting 31.
I do not have a knock sensor. I'd like to make sure I am getting the value from the main spark table when at WOT.
Double check the log for RPM & MAP to make sure of what area of the SA table you are looking at.
As for tables that can subtract from the SA, there are several. The main ones are the "SA - Coolant Comp Spark Advance" and "SA - IAT/CTS Compensation" tables.
Two others are the "SA - PE Reduction vs. MPH" table and the "SA - PE Reduction in 4th (auto only)" scalar.
Thanks Rbob, I'm double checking the logs. At 3200 RPM I'm at 30* advance and 97KPa, and all the way up to 5500 RPM it doesn't go above 32*. And Confirming the SA Main and Extended table show 35.16* in every cell from 90 to 100 KPa and 3600 to 6000.
SA-PE Reduction vs MPH is zero'd for all cells. I'm showing the other tables below. The SA Coolant Bias and SA IAT Bias constant are both set at the default of 9.84.
I'm afraid I still don't understand why I am not getting up to 35 degrees advance. Can you suggest what I should change?
Thanks!!
Timing is being pulled via the "SA - IAT/CTS Compensation" table. Any value less then the bias is removing SA.
RBob.
What RBob said, but can't just change a single value in a table because of the way the code interpolates a table. Need to change all values "around" RPM and temp of concern to ensure the exact value desired is extracted.